Ever make a big mistake when in your job search or in an interview?

Did you ever miss a scheduled interview, blank on an easy question from a manager, or botch things so bad you had no chance of saving yourself?  How did you overcome it or how did you bounce back?

My favorite example (well now…) was back a year to two after college.  I got referred to a sales company by a buddy and was in the interview.  I was doing well.  They were giving me good feedback, and I was super excited about the job.  The one buddy was really liking his time at the company, was bragging about making his $100k or something (which was the equivalent of $30M per year to a naive 24 year old me), and I was apparently a “lock” to get it.

Then one of the two interviewers ends with this question:

“What’s this guy’s name?”  (as he points to his partner…)

I had no clue.  Blank.  He did introduce himself earlier.  His name was super uncommon, like Orion or something, but I was lost.

It cost me the job.  I “didn’t pay attention to important details” they said.  That sucked.

Obviously, you’ve got to remember names, and sometimes crap happens. This one’s kinda funny to me now, but I still think about it.  Keep going and do better next time.
